Malaysia: Election Commission asked to investigate registration of phantom voters
Offered by:

KUALA LUMPUR: Marang Umno division chief Datuk Abdul Rahman Bakar has called on the Election Commission to investigate the registration of phantom voters in the Rhu Rhendang seat in Marang, Terengganu.
Abdul Rahman, who is Marang MP and Deputy Human Resources Minister, claimed that PAS had brought in hundreds of phantom voters.
He said he lodged a report with the Terengganu state EC on Nov 6, when he found 541 additional voters registered in the constituency.
“The Marang Umno division has been monitoring the situation since June – we find the number of phantom voters rising every day,” he told reporters at the Parliament lobby here on Tuesday.
“PAS is bringing in phantom voters because they want to retain the state seat.”
He said the phantom voters were mostly from Selangor, Klang, Petaling Jaya, Kuantan and Penang
